Description

A great opportunity for first time buyers to purchase this recently renovated three bedroom mid terrace property in the Copleston catchment area.

The Property - A charming Edwardian mid-terrace house situated on the East of Ipswich. This delightful property boasts two reception rooms, perfect for entertaining guests. With two double bedrooms and a further single, it is an ideal family home.

The property features a modern bathroom on the ground floor, ensuring your comfort and convenience. Spanning across 807 sqft, this house offers a perfect blend of space and warmth, making it a wonderful place to call home.

Convenience is key, and with parking available for one vehicle, you can bid farewell to the stress of searching for a parking spot.

Don't miss out on the opportunity to make this lovely house on Alan Road your new home!

Location - The desirable East Ipswich location of this property gives easy access to Ipswich mainline train station & Derby Road station, bus routes, Ipswich hospital & colleges, Holywells Park, restaurants, shops & other amenities.

The property is extremely convenient for not only the highly sought after Copleston and Britannia Schools, but also for an excellent range of local shops and amenities with easy access into Ipswich town and waterfront or out onto the A14.

Ground Floor -

Entrance Porch - With inset coconut mat and window to side, door leading to:

Lounge - 3.35 x 3.15 (10'11" x 10'4") - Great size lounge with newly fitted carpet, feature mantlepiece and window overlooking the front aspect.

Dining Room - 3.35 x 3.16 (10'11" x 10'4") - Further reception room with newly fitted carpets and two storage cupboards under the stairs. Door leading to:

Kitchen - 3.68 x 3.35 (12'0" x 10'11") - A modern fitted kitchen with a range of white wall and base Shaker style units with wood worktop, stainless steel sink with drainer, space for dishwasher and fridge freezer, integrated single oven and inset electric hob, stainless steel overhead cooker hood and tiled splashback surround. With Herringbone style vinyl flooring throughout and door leading to:

Utility - 1.61 x 0.96 (5'3" x 3'1") - Small utility housing the boiler and worktop with space and plumbing under for a washing machine.

Bathroom - 2.39 x 1.61 (7'10" x 5'3") - A modern tiled three piece bathroom suite comprising P-shape bath with mixer shower, pedestal hand wash basin and low level WC. Herringbone style vinyl flooring with window to side aspect.

First Floor -

Bedroom One - 3.35 x 3.15 (10'11" x 10'4") - Great sized double bedroom overlooking the front aspect, new carpet and storage cupboard over the stairs.

Bedroom Two - 3.16 x 2.40 (10'4" x 7'10") - Further double bedroom located to the rear of the property with window overlooking the garden and new carpet.

Bedroom Three - 2.60 x 1.77 (8'6" x 5'9") - Single bedroom overlooking the rear aspect with window to rear garden.

Outside - To the rear is a 80ft (approx) East facing garden, with a patio area to the back of the property and the remainder mainly laid-to-lawn. The garden is enclosed by panel fencing and has a pathway leading to the rear of the garden with a raised area and a wooden shed.

The front of the property is a hard standing area with an iron fence to one side and brick wall to the other.
